Why Flat-Fee Property Management Can Make Sense

Under percentage-based pricing, a property owner’s management fee automatically increases when the rent increases—even if the fundamental work required to manage the property remains largely the same.

For example, increasing the monthly rent from $2,750 to $3,250 raises a 10% management fee from $275 to $325. That represents an additional $600 in annual management fees.

Questions to Ask Any South Florida Property Manager

  1. Is the monthly management fee flat or calculated as a percentage of rent?
  2. Does the management fee increase when the rent increases?
  3. Are there separate leasing or tenant-placement fees?
  4. Is there a lease-renewal fee?
  5. Are maintenance-coordination fees or vendor markups charged?
  6. Are routine property inspections included?
  7. What happens to the management fee while the property is vacant?
  8. Who coordinates repairs and turnover work?
  9. Which services are included, and which are billed separately?
  10. What would the estimated total annual cost be for my particular property?

A meaningful comparison should account for the entire management relationship—not just one percentage shown on a pricing page.
